Full description
This is the long climb — from the dry-zone plain at around 100 metres to Nuwara Eliya at 1,900, crossing the entire middle of the island. The landscape changes three times and it is worth stopping to notice.
Dambulla is the first stop, fifteen minutes from Sigiriya: five caves under a granite overhang painted continuously for two thousand years, with around 150 Buddha images. The approach path is steeper than it looks.
Matale is spice country. The gardens grow cinnamon, cardamom, pepper, nutmeg and vanilla together, and a guided walk makes the differences obvious in a way that reading about them does not.
Kandy is roughly halfway and the stop is short — the lake and the outside of the Temple of the Tooth, unless you want to add an hour and the fee to go in. From Kandy the road climbs and does not stop, and around Ramboda the forest gives way to tea.
You reach Nuwara Eliya in the afternoon, at 1,900 metres, where the air is cold and the town still has the racecourse, the golf course and the mock-Tudor post office the British left behind.
